    Quote Originally Posted by BigJAG2004 View Post
    My brother didn't know that Twist and Shout was by The Beatles.

    I knew that since I was like 6, and he's 16.
    To be fair, the Beatles version is a cover, and a version by the Isley Brothers (also a cover) was about equally famous.

    And yeah a poster above mentioned that Boys was a cover,what alot of people dont realize im sure is,back in the Hamburg days while they were playing as a backup band,and even in the CavernClub,quite a few songs were infact covers.I believe it wasnt until Hard Days Night that every song on an album,was written by the Lennon/McCartney team,
